Although Scrat and his preshistoric buddies from Fox/Blue Sky’s Ice Age: The Meltdown may have been snubbed by many of the year-end critics and awards groups, they are laughing all the way to the bank. According to a report released last week by Kagan Research, the movie was the most profitable, widely released feature of 2006. Produced with an estimated price tag of $256.4 million, Ice Age: The Meltdown brought in $1.1 billion during its all-release windows, placing it high on the list of Kagan’s profitability index.

Blue Sky Studios is auctioning original concept art from their movies "Ice Age" and "Robots" for the victims of hurricanes Katrina and Rita.
We have been working for weeks on acquiring rights to auction off artwork in order tohelp raise money for the hurricane victims this year. It may seem late in the game, but the impact from the hurricanes will unfortunately last for many years, so will it still help? Hell yes.
The auction will launch on Friday Dec 9th and run for 10 days on Ebay. Please pass this along to your friends and anyone else who you think might be remotely interested. Our auction campaign is entirely grassroots and we have no official promotional channels to use.
